The United Nations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organization (UNESCO) World Heritage Sites are places of importance to cultural or natural heritage. Below is the list of sites in Bosnia and Herzegovina.

Mehmed Paša Sokolović Bridge in Višegrad | 2007 | II,IV | Republika Srpska, Sarajevo Macro Region | ![]() | |
Old Bridge Area of the Old City of Mostar | 2005 | VI | Herzegovina-Neretva Canton | ![]() | |
Stećaks - Mediaeval Tombstones | 2016 | II,III,VI | Joint Cultural Heritage by the four countries (Bosnia and Herzegovina, Croatia, Montenegro and Serbia). | ![]() |
Stećak is the name for medieval tombstones. Most of the stećaks are in poor condition. |
